This Honey BBQ Sausage Pasta is a bold and hearty dish that combines smoky sausage with the sweet tangy of honey barbecue sauce. The pasta is rotini, holds the sauce beautifully in every spiral, making each bite full of flavor. Seared the slice sausage to bring out their smoky and savory profile, then tossed into the pasta and sauce mixture, creating a sweet, tangy, and slightly smoky flavor experience. Finished with a sprinkle of fresh parsley for brightness, this dish is as visually appealing as it is satisfying.

Honey BBQ Sausage Pasta
Ingredients
- 13 oz Smoked Sausage
- 8 oz to 10 oz Rotini Pasta
- 1 cup BBQ Sauce
- ½ cup Honey
- 1 Onion chopped
- 1 Sweet Palermo Pepper
- 5 to 6 Garlic Gloves
- 2 cups Chicken Broth
- ¼ cup to ½ cup Parmesan Cheese shredded
- ¼ cup Fresh Parsley chopped
- 1 cup Heavy Whipping Cream
- 1 teaspoon Season Salt
- ½ teaspoon Black Pepper
- 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der
- 1 teaspoon Onion Powder
- 2 tablespoon Olive Oil
Instructions
- In a large pot, bring salted water to a boil.
- Add rotini pasta and cook until al dente according to package directions.
- Drain and set aside.
-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at
- Add sliced sausage and diced onions
- Cook until sausage is browned and onions are softened, about five to seven minutes
- Stir in chicken broth, heavy cream, honey BBQ sauce, uncooked pasta, garlic powder, salt, and pepper
-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low
- Simmer, stirring occasionally, until pasta is cooked and the sauce thickens, about ten to twelve minutes
- Remove from heat and stir in parmesanr cheese until melted and creamy
- Serve warm, garnished with chopped parsley if desired
